Subject: Dock hours — night shift

Team, reminder from the front desk: the Orliss Street dock takes deliveries 06:00–17:00 only. Overnight arrivals get redirected unless flagged in the log by day staff. Don't lift the shutter for anyone unlisted. Drivers wait outside the gate, not in the yard. If a listed delivery arrives, open the pedestrian dock door with this code:

door code, yagap-bahof: bdg-O-05

Ticket PLX-4471: Expired credentials for baseline sync

The nightly job that refreshes the static-analysis baseline file for the Grindstone repo is failing because its credential for the internal Lintkeeper service expired last night. Until it's fixed, new findings can't be diffed against the baseline and CI will flag everything as new. On-call: update the job's secret in the scheduler config and rerun the sync. The replacement key has been provisioned and is included below.

gateway credential: kto3_qfe

Re: the Stallgrid occupancy feed PR. Sensor events arrive out of order; your merge logic assumes monotonic timestamps. Fixed upstream of you once already — see the Corvane garage incident writeup. Use the sequence watermark, not wall clock. Also, don't poll the gate controllers faster than the debounce interval or you'll double-count exits during shift change. New team members: all polling and smoothing knobs live in one constants block, reviewed as a unit, never tweaked per-garage. The current agreed values appear below.

tuning constants:
QUOTAS = {
    "druwyn": 5,
    "holix": 5,
    "zorath": 5,
    "holwyn": 10,
}